JolliBots are back to take play time to the next level!

The robot-themed Jolly Kiddie Meal toys are back! With its highly successful launch last February, Jollibee is bringing back the well-loved JolliBots starting July 16 to the delight of many kids and kids-at-heart.
The JolliBots have returned! Collect all five toys and take play time to the next level!

The JolliBots are making a much-awaited comeback to provide an enjoyable playtime for kids as they transform their favorite Jollibee food items into their favorite mascots.

Leading the pack is Jollibee who pops out of a Chickenjoy Bucket by retracting both arms and flipping its lid. Simply twisting and turning the upper corners of the Jolly Spaghetti box will reveal Hetty. Those who love the Jollibee Chocolate Sundae will also enjoy revealing Twirlie from the robot cup—just split the ice cream portion and rotate the arms to extend the toy figure. Kids can complete the JolliBots experience with the robotized Jolly Crispy Fries and Yumburger. They just have to flip the upper portions of the toys to reveal Popo and Yum, respectively.

All Jolly Kiddie Meal toys are designed with eye-catching colors and designs that will surely give Jolly kids loads of fun! Each of the five collectible pieces are available with every purchase of a Yumburger (P82), Yumburger Meal with Drink (P102), Jolly Spaghetti (P97), Jolly Spaghetti Meal with Drink (P107), 1-pc. Burger Steak (P97), 1-pc. Burger Steak Meal with Drink (P114), 1-pc. Chickenjoy with rice (P129), or a 1-pc. Chickenjoy Meal with Drink (P144), each coming with its own Jolly Joy Box. Collectors can also get their hands on the complete set with a purchase of the 6-pc. Chickenjoy Bucket for only P624.

What’s your #LanguageOfThanks? Jollibee encourages people to show gratitude through actions this Family Thanksgiving Month

The past two years were filled with challenges and changes brought about by the pandemic. The ensuing lockdown resulted to many Filipinos spending time with their families more than ever before, but for some it meant an extended period of isolation from their loved ones. Either way, the situation made Filipinos rediscover the value of and gratitude for family – that through it all they will always have the love and support of their family.

Inspired by this rekindled appreciation, Jollibee launched the Family Thanksgiving Month in May 2021. Now in its second year, the country’s number one fast-food chain seeks to continue the tradition of showing and expressing gratitude for the family through words, and even more so through actions.

For this year’s Family Thanksgiving Month, Jollibee asks Filipinos: What’s your Language of Thanks? 

Whether it’s a drive-thru surprise after school, a fresh sweldo day treat, a handmade gift, or simply helping out with chores, Jollibee encourages everyone to show their appreciation to the people that matter most through the “My Language of Thanks” Instagram movement. People from all walks of life can participate by following Jollibee on Instagram and sharing their unique but heartwarming ways of saying thank you through actions.

“After two years in our respective bubbles, we are now bracing ourselves into the new normal. But we can't forget the people who have been with us and will continue to be our support system throughout these new circumstances—our families. This Family Thanksgiving Month, we encourage our customers to keep the spirit of joy and gratitude alive by showing their appreciation to the people who matter most in their lives through actions,” shared Francis Flores, Jollibee Global and Jollibee Philippines Marketing Head.

For Jollibee endorsers like Maja Salvador, Liza Soberano, Joshua Garcia, and Scarlet Snow Belo, one of the ways to show gratitude for their loved ones is by treating them with their favorite comfort food—Jollibee! The four-posted Jollibee family salu-salo videos on their respective Instagram accounts, in which they also encouraged their followers to share their own ways of showing thanks.

‘Wag matakot sa delivery! Your Jollibee favorites now made #MasAffordelivery!

When cravings suddenly strike, there’s nothing like the convenience of having food delivered straight to your doorstep. But sometimes, this convenience comes at an extra cost—literally. Fear of high inclusive delivery fees and minimum order requirements make it harder to have food delivered for someone on a tight budget.

Luckily, Jollibee Delivery now offers customers a #MasAffordelivery experience! Now, everyone’s favorite langhap-sarap Jollibee favorites are same priced as dine-in, so customers can order their favorites guilt-free wherever they are. Whether a customer is ordering just for his or her own meal, or if they prefer to treat their friends and family, Jollibee Delivery has implemented a fixed delivery fee of P49, taking away the fear of having a high percentage of the total bill dedicated to just delivery fees. There’s also no need to keep adding orders beyond one’s need because there is no minimum order requirement for web and app orders.

In its newest video laced with fun and humor, Jollibee shows that the fear is real when it comes to the high cost for having your favorite meals delivered. But not anymore, with these new features – same as dine-in price, fixed delivery fee, and no minimum order requirement for web and app orders – treating oneself with some Jollibee Delivery won’t hurt the pocket, so there’s no reason to be afraid.

Kwentong Jollibee’s short films define love with true, modern-day Pinoy stories

What is the real meaning of love? This is the question that Jollibee aims to answer with its latest heartfelt and swoon-worthy Kwentong Jollibee Valentine's series.

Back at it again after the series’ continuous success, Jollibee and McCann WorldGroup keep Kwentong Jollibee episodes real and fresh by exploring new, true-to-life stories unique to the experiences of Filipinos in these current times. 

Find the real meaning of love with Kwentong Jollibee’s heartfelt Valentine's films now available on the Jollibee Studios YouTube channel and Jollibee Facebook page.

The shorts 600 Days and Dream Guy are directed by Antoinette Jadaone, while ILY is directed by JP Habac. Both acclaimed filmmakers have captured the hearts of Pinoy audiences with previous Kwentong Jollibee episodes–LDR (2021) by Jadaone and the smash-hit One True Pair The Movie (2021) featuring John Lloyd Cruz and Bea Alonzo by Habac.

To date, the series has amassed more than 44.6 million views on the Jollibee Studios YouTube channel and the Jollibee Facebook page combined.

“What makes every Kwentong Jollibee film resonate and touch the lives of Filipinos is that these stories are rooted in the Filipino experience. We continuously make an effort to have our viewers know that their emotions, situations, problems, and successes are seen and heard while constantly reminding them that while the world may change, love will always remain constant and unflinching,” said Arline Adeva, Jollibee Assistant Vice President and Head of Brand PR, Engagement, and Digital Marketing.

Finding the real meaning of love

As we continue to experience “love in the time of corona”, the challenges that come with it have repeatedly redefined love for some and shown the real meaning of love to others. 

In this year’s Kwentong Jollibee Valentines series we get a genuine snapshot of this era - from lockdown relationships to K-drama crushes – as well as nuanced definitions of love from different perspectives.  

“One thing that sets Kwentong Jollibee apart is how it’s always current and timely. It’s culled from life lessons and stories of different people through experiences brought by the times,” said Sid Samodio, McCann WorldGroup Philippines Executive Creative Director.

Staying true to its purpose of narrating authentic Pinoy stories on Valentine’s Day and other red-letter occasions, the episodes allow audiences to feel both seen and represented. The first episode entitled “600 Days”, in particular, is a sequel to last year’s “LDR” and accurately captures the realities of relationships affected by the pandemic.

“Two years into the pandemic, we found that people were in a state of uncertainty. There have been so many stops and starts, with everybody needing to adjust to the constant changes. And in a world where people are becoming increasingly separated from one another, and where more relationships are formed and maintained online instead of face to face, where can we find the real meaning of love?” he said, explaining the thought behind this year’s Kwentong Jollibee Valentine’s series.

This authenticity is what Pinoys keep coming back to even after years since Kwentong Jollibee’s first viral hit in 2017. With about 800 million views on Jollibee’s official Facebook page and Jollibee Studios YouTube channel and continued sparks of conversation in the digital sphere, it’s safe to say that the Kwentong Jollibee series holds the same space in Pinoy hearts as Jollibee’s langhap-sarap meals.

Watch Kwentong Jollibee’s latest Valentine series to find out what does love truly mean?

What does love truly mean? This February, the award-winning and highly anticipated Kwentong Jollibee Valentine series is back to tug at everyone’s heartstrings, launching a new trio of special short films that show the different ways people experience love and discover its true meaning.

“It’s the sixth year of the Kwentong Jollibee Valentine series and what we always realize is that love comes in different forms and can be defined in myriad ways, unique from person to person. The stories were inspired by true-to-life experiences of real people in the pandemic, with unexpected twists that lead people into finding what love truly means for them,” said Jollibee AVP and Head of Brand PR, Engagement and Digital Marketing, Arline Adeva.
Directed by Antoinette Jadaone and JP Habac, the Kwentong Jollibee 2022 Valentines series tugs the heart of Filipinos with stories of finding real love.

“As in our past runs of Kwentong Jollibee, our goal is to celebrate the uniqueness of each love story and showcase the timeless lessons that can inspire and give hope to our viewers. All three episodes are anchored on powerful truths that surfaced during these challenging times when all kinds of relationships were somehow put to the test.” she added.

Pandemic or not, no Valentine’s Day is complete without a Kwentong Jollibee series. Last year’s viral triple treat—LDR, First Date, and Hero—showcased that strength can be found in love, especially one that is determined to make things work despite hardships. This year, Jollibee is at it again with a new trilogy that is sure to touch the hearts of audiences across generations.

Hold on to real love in the face of never-ending challenges with the Kwentong Jollibee “600 Days” Valentines episode.

600 Days, is love worth the trouble? —This is the question posed by Brian and Mina’s story which is, set to premiere on February 9 on the brand’s official Facebook page. The couple was first introduced in last year’s #LDR, which chronicled their struggles as the distance and pandemic kept them apart. They thought the worst is over, but as the pandemic progresses, new challenges keep rocking their relationship. Do they have what it takes to still make things work? Find out in this heartwarming sequel by the same director of Kwentong Jollibee LDR, Antoinette Jadaone.

Kwentong Jollibee’s “Dream Guy” is a swoon-worthy love story made for the K-drama fans.

Dream Guy, which will be released on February 13, tells the story of Kaye, a hallyu fan who dreams of having her own ultimate oppa love story. For her, meeting Jung feels like starring in her very own K-drama, but he might not be what she imagined him to be. This charming love story also helmed by Jadaone will surely delight the hearts of Korean love story fans.

Meet the different types of love through the stories of three girlkada members on 
Kwentong Jollibee’s “ILY”.

ILY, streaming on February 18, is a different kind of love story that will make young people realize all the more the value of the people they have in their lives. Directed by JP Habac (who also directed the recent blockbuster short film One True Pair The Movie), it’s the perfect short film to watch with your besties or even the whole family.

Kwentong Jollibee has released 36 short films since it was first introduced in 2017. Inspired by the genuine life experiences of the brand’s loyal customers, the episodes have truly resonated among Jollibee fans of all ages, marking more than 800 million views on Facebook and YouTube. And with the way the episodes thread together the universal experiences of pain, love, and loss, the storytelling is truly felt by people all over the world — leading Kwentong Jollibee to receive recognitions both locally and abroad.
